[10:39:57] <half_a_pony> Всем привет. Раньше при компиляции ядра можно было менять параметры в .config, теперь при выполнении make ARCH=arm CROSS_COMPILE=arm-linux-gnueabi- конфиг перезаписывается. Как-то можно внести изменения в .config? Нужно ядро с конфигом, отличным от дефолтного
[10:42:08] <stuw> half_a_pony, перезаписывается? make ARCH=arm CROSS_COMPILE=arm-linux-gnueabi- paz00_defconfig <- только эта операция должна менять конфиг.
[10:42:14] <stuw> потом вроде можно его менять
[10:48:25] <half_a_pony> user@user-VirtualBox:~/marvin24s-kernel$ make ARCH=arm CROSS_COMPILE=arm-linux-gnueabi- -j3
[10:48:32] <half_a_pony> scripts/kconfig/conf --silentoldconfig Kconfig
[10:48:40] <half_a_pony> # configuration written to .config
[10:49:06] <half_a_pony> Это если что-то менял в .config. Если он дефолтный, то такого не будет.
[10:49:29] <stuw> make ARCH=arm CROSS_COMPILE=arm-linux-gnueabi- menuconfig ?
[10:52:10] <stuw> не знаю, правда, поможет это или нет :(
[10:54:14] <half_a_pony> спасибо, я, кажется, понял.
[10:54:21] <half_a_pony> у меня в конфиге параметры
[10:54:30] <half_a_pony> которых, видимо, нет в этом ядре
[10:54:36] <half_a_pony> CONFIG_WEXT_PRIV
[10:54:51] <half_a_pony> собираю драйвер для внешней wifi-карты
[10:54:57] <stuw> ясно. я какое ядро собираешь?
[10:55:07] <half_a_pony> 3.1.10+
[10:55:36] <stuw> а без ядра драйвер не собирается?
[10:55:54] <half_a_pony> нет, ему нужно полное дерево исходников
[11:04:23] <half_a_pony> лол.
[11:04:39] <half_a_pony> это смешно, но я руками поправил этот драйвер и он скомпилился
[11:04:55] <half_a_pony> если еще и заработает, то вообще фантастика
[11:14:15] <half_a_pony> таки нет, не работает. Однако работает без установки драйверов в десктопной 12.10, интересно, есть ли шансы, что заработает и на нетбуке в 12.10?
[11:17:13] <akri> добрый день! вопрос не по теме, но близко. acer iconia tab a701. подключаю к opensuse 12.1 - lsusb его видит, а adb нет.
[11:19:09] <half_a_pony> http://forums.opensuse.org/english/other-forums/development/programming-scripting/475620-adb-android-debug-bridge-doesnt-work.html
[11:19:16] <half_a_pony> не похоже?
[11:20:10] <akri> возможно. спасибо за отклик
[12:03:04] <dpol> stuw: привет... 3.8 еще не тестил ?..
[12:04:46] <stuw> привет. тестил на переразбитой тошке с бутлоадером от 2.2. у меня cmdline не подхватывается
[12:05:29] <stuw> хз почему
[12:06:01] <dpol> ...его нуна в .config прописывать, из образа *.img он не подхватывается...
[12:06:16] <stuw> шайсе )
[12:07:40] <dpol> stuw: ...кхм, у тебя случаем не наблюдается такая ситуация, что: судя по логам, у меня - while (true) {определился модем; модем disconnected;} ... :)
[12:07:52] <stuw> у меня модема нет. у меня 117
[12:08:54] <dpol> stuw: ...када опишешь захватывающий рассказ по переразбивке ?.. :)
[12:09:30] <stuw> я не до конца все проверил (есть еще пара идей), но начать могу сегодня )
[12:10:51] <stuw> dpol, ты на каком ядре собираешься жить? )
[12:10:59] <stuw> с 3.8 должен u-boot работать
[12:11:00] <dpol> stuw: ...а что, в кратце, дает переразбивка ?.. от tegrapart не избавляемся ?.. ну и более феншуйной разбивке места...
[12:11:30] <stuw> избавляемся
[12:12:08] <dpol> ...меня 3.8 вполне устраивает, графика - фик с ней, рано или поздно прикрутят...
[12:12:55] <dpol> ...mainline 3.8 меня смущает тем, что акромя tegrapart там еще куча патчей марвина...
[12:13:41] <stuw> суть такая - на карте есть скрытое место (на некоторых тошках две партиции по 1 MiB, на некоторых две по 2 MiB). В эти партиции можно запихать BCT + u-boot или bct + fastboot + PT (PT нужен, чтобы fastboot нашел партицию LNX). На нескрытом месте (/dev/mmcblk0) можно делать любую разме
[12:13:41] <stuw> тку
[12:13:43] <dpol> ...для device-tree, дрова к nvec, etc...
[12:14:22] <stuw> скрытые партиции - /dev/mmcblk0boot0 и /dev/mmcblk0boot1
[12:15:04] <dpol> ...как я понял, это фейковые разделы, которые драйвер emmc сам себе нафантазировал... :)
[12:15:05] <stuw> dpol, надо у марвина узнать, может быть эти патчи нужно в мейнлайн пушить
[12:15:23] <stuw> dpol, нет. эти области описаны в регистре контроллера
[12:15:56] <stuw> они как раз и сделаны, чтобы туда пихать специфичный для девайса загрузчик
[12:16:06] <dpol> stuw: ...может к выходу 3.8. в виде fix'ов и запушат... в рассылке изменения уже с прицелом на 3.9 публикуют...
[12:19:07] <dpol> stuw: ...тут ссылка проскакивала, на страничку где u-boot пилят... по ней все должно получиться (с веткой marvin24-linux-ac100-3.8) ?..
[12:20:33] <stuw> можешь u-boot в память запихать для проверки, а не сразу на карту шить
[13:10:26] <akri> отладка была отключена - вот и не виделся планшет
[13:36:36] <dpol> stuw: ok, спс...
[13:42:55] <ZurbaXI> какие перспективы открываются)) можно два ядра запихать, прямо как в интел дуал коре)
[13:43:10] <stuw> ))
[13:43:43] <stuw> главное, чтобы это заработало. Иначе придется юзать загрузчик 2.2 (для тошек с маленькими boot партициями)
[13:46:36] <ZurbaXI> stuw, а как определить 2мб или 1 у меня?
[13:47:09] <stuw> ZurbaXI, dmesg
[13:47:54] <ZurbaXI> а ну да, провтыкал
[13:48:08] <stuw> ZurbaXI, если у тебя 116, то там 2 MiB
[13:55:03] <ZurbaXI> stuw, именно так)
[14:01:00] <ZurbaXI> stuw, bct_dump: command no found
[14:01:42] <stuw> ZurbaXI, тебе она зачем?
[14:02:04] <stuw> в архиве моем все подготовлено
[14:02:24] <ZurbaXI> ну я пытался всю цепочку пройти)
[14:03:00] <stuw> bct_dump собирать надо. он вместе с cbootimg собирается
[14:03:23] <ZurbaXI> ладно тогда пока проехали
[14:04:03] <stuw> ZurbaXI, лучше проверь, что единый образ BCT+EBT работает. если работает, можно будет разбивку партиций мутить
[14:04:35] <ZurbaXI> хорошо, ну что шить?
[14:04:52] <stuw> поменяй gpt.sh и потом его запускай
[14:05:08] <stuw> 1M на 2M поменяй в 2-х местах
[14:05:15] <ZurbaXI> угу
[14:09:37] <ZurbaXI> failed executing command 4 NvError 0x120002
[14:09:37] <ZurbaXI> setbct failed NvError 0x0
[14:09:37] <ZurbaXI> command failure: bootloader download failed (bad data)
[14:10:00] <stuw> полный вывод на пастебин плиз
[14:10:02] <stuw> :)
[14:15:15] <stuw> ZurbaXI, обнови архив
[14:19:27] <ZurbaXI> =)
[14:19:50] <stuw> блин
[14:20:27] <stuw> не залился файл ac100-android21.bctpt
[14:22:22] <stuw> truncate ac100-android21.bctpt -s 1132544
[14:22:40] <stuw> sudo ./nvflash --bl fastboot.bin --rawdevicewrite 0 553 ac100-android21.bctpt
[14:22:52] <ZurbaXI> угу
[14:23:11] <stuw> сделал? пробуй загрузить тошку. если видишь лого - все ок
[14:25:34] <ZurbaXI> сделал, подсветка экрана горит, лого не вижу, не всё ок)
[14:25:53] <stuw> шайсе )
[14:26:04] <stuw> попробуй в 6-ю партицию инсталлер убунты залить
[14:32:51] <stuw> ZurbaXI, ну что там?
[14:33:44] <ZurbaXI> вот такие дела
[14:34:24] <stuw> хм...
[14:36:10] <stuw> похоже вариант с объединением BCT и EBT не прокатывает
[14:36:37] <ZurbaXI> так я прошить загрузчик не могу даже в тошу теперь)
[14:37:22] <stuw> я знаю )
[14:37:27] <stuw> это не страшно
[14:40:37] <stuw> ZurbaXI, у тебя есть на внешнем носителе какой линукс для тошки или ты все время внутренний накопитель использовал?
[14:42:22] <ZurbaXI> всмысле бекап?
[14:42:55] <ZurbaXI> stuw, бека есть
[14:43:24] <stuw> не бэкап, а рабочий линукс. (который стоит на sd карте и грузится оттуда)
[14:43:41] <ZurbaXI> а не такого нет
[14:46:55] <stuw> ок, сейчас скрипт обновлю )
[14:46:58] <stuw> есть идея одна
[14:50:15] <stuw> ZurbaXI, обнови архив :)
[14:50:28] <stuw> если это не прокатит, то придется видимо делать по старинке
[14:50:38] <stuw> (по вчерашней разработке)
[14:50:39] <stuw> :))
[14:51:06] <stuw> стоп
[14:51:10] <stuw> ошибка там
[14:51:53] <ZurbaXI> жду)) мне правда на работу, но один раз прошится успеем наверное)
[14:52:29] <stuw> ZurbaXI, в gpt.sh поменяй 512 на 1024
[14:55:06] <ZurbaXI> в новом архиве или старом
[14:55:09] <ZurbaXI> ?
[14:56:01] <stuw> в новом
[14:58:58] <ZurbaXI> прощилось залилось stuw
[15:02:36] <ZurbaXI> залил загрузчик убунту, всё равно не реагирует
[15:03:07] <ZurbaXI> я буду ближе к полуночи stuw )
[23:39:49] <zombah> stuw_: привет, ты тут?
[23:40:35] <stuw_> zombah, привет
[23:40:36] <stuw_> тут
[23:40:58] <zombah> stuw_: можешь плиз глянуть вот этот код https://github.com/CyanogenMod/android_device_asus_grouper/blob/cm-10.1/audio/audio_route.c#L34
[23:41:18] <zombah> получаю в нем вот эту ошибку https://github.com/CyanogenMod/android_device_asus_grouper/blob/cm-10.1/audio/audio_route.c#L417
[23:41:32] <zombah> никак не вкурю что ему нужно в значении MIXER_CARD
[23:42:36] <stuw_> zombah, где mixer_open определена ?
[23:42:53] <zombah> хм счас найду
[23:44:37] <zombah> похоже во внешней либе, счас все дерево грепну
[23:48:38] <zombah> https://github.com/CyanogenMod/android_external_tinyalsa/blob/cm-10.1/mixer.c#L90
[23:49:19] <stuw_> zombah, ls -l /dev/snd/
[23:49:38] <stuw_> controlC девайсы нужны
[23:50:00] <zombah> C0 у нас, но чтот я ставил ноль он тогда в корку падает
[23:50:13] <stuw_> ну в другом месте падает
[23:50:59] <zombah> мда дела, счас попробую с нулем еще раз посмотрю кто там дальше страдает
[23:52:50] <zombah> еще глюк нашел в новом андроиде не хочет конфиг клавы нашей подгружать, вообще бред почему так
[13:20:55] <zombah> добрый день
[16:12:45] * Disconnected (Remote host closed socket).
[16:13:18] * Now talking on #ac100-ru
[16:13:18] * Topic for #ac100-ru is: Канал пользователей смартбука Toshiba AC-100 | Вики: http://ac100.wikispaces.com || use UTF-8 dude || Логи: http://logs.paz00.net http://stuw.narod.ru/ac100/irc/
[16:13:18] * Topic for #ac100-ru set by [email protected] at Tue Jul 24 12:06:59 2012